Market Context

In recent weeks, MO has been trading with slightly below average volume, per aggregated market data, indicating limited conviction from both buyers and sellers in the current price range. The broader consumer staples sector has seen mixed trading activity this month, as investors balance defensive positioning amid ongoing macroeconomic uncertainty with concerns around evolving regulatory frameworks for tobacco and nicotine products, which disproportionately impact names like Altria Group Inc. Broader market sentiment has shifted frequently between risk-on and risk-off modes recently, leading to increased rotation between high-growth equities and defensive, dividend-paying names such as MO. There have been no material company-specific announcements from Altria in recent sessions, so most short-term price moves have been tied to sector-wide trends and macro signals, including shifting market expectations for upcoming interest rate adjustments, which often influence demand for high-yield defensive assets. Technical Analysis

From a technical standpoint, MO is currently trading within a well-defined near-term range, with key support identified at $60.96 and immediate overhead resistance at $67.38, per consensus technical analysis from market analysts.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) is currently in the low 40s, a level that signals the stock is neither deeply oversold nor overbought, suggesting limited directional momentum in either direction as of this month. MO is also trading between its short-term and medium-term moving averages, further confirming the lack of a clear short-term trend. Recent tests of the $60.96 support level have seen modest buying interest emerge to limit downside, while tentative moves toward the $67.38 resistance level have historically been met with increased selling pressure that has capped upward moves so far this month. Trading ranges of this nature can persist for extended periods until a clear catalyst emerges to drive a breakout in either direction. Outlook

Looking ahead, there are two primary scenarios that market participants are monitoring for MO in the upcoming weeks. A sustained breakout above the $67.38 resistance level, paired with above-average trading volume, could signal a potential shift in near-term momentum, possibly leading to a test of higher price levels as buying interest picks up. Conversely, a confirmed break below the $60.96 support level on elevated volume may indicate building downside pressure, which could lead to further short-term declines as sellers take control. Market expectations suggest that upcoming macroeconomic data releases, including inflation prints and central bank policy announcements, could act as catalysts for moves across the consumer staples sector, which may impact MO’s trajectory. Analysts also note that unexpected regulatory updates related to nicotine product marketing or distribution could introduce additional volatility that pushes the stock outside of its current trading range. As of now, there are no confirmed upcoming earnings releases for Altria Group Inc. listed on public corporate calendars.
